    ANALISIS FRONT WHEEL ALIGNMENT (FWA) PADA RANCANG BANGUN KENDARAAN OFF ROAD TIPE TOYOTA FJ40

    Tugas Akhir ini membahas tentang Analisis Front wheel Alingment pada kendaraan Toyota FJ40. Yang bertujuan untuk menghasilkan stabilitas dalam pengemudian kendaraan dan Mengetahui apa saja penyebab ketidakstabilan front wheel alignment. Sudut geometris dan ukuran roda-roda depan, yang terdiri dari Camber, Caster, Toe Angel, Kingpin inclination, dan Turning radius merupakan bagian penting yang ada pada Front Wheel Aligmnet. Apabila salah satu dari elemen wheel alignmet tidak tepat maka akan menimbulkan ketidakstabilan bagi sipengemudi. Waktu dan jarak maksimum perawatan roda dan perawatan Front wheel alignment yang dibutuhkan untuk menjaga agar tetap stabil maka dilakukan perawatan berkala stiap 10,000 km dan selalu mengechek kondi fisik dari ban agar menghidari slip pada saat mengemudi

    THE ANALYSIS OF FRONT WHEEL ALIGNMENT (FWA) ON THE VEHICLE DESIGN OFF ROAD TOYOTA TYPE FJ40

    This final project discusses the analysis of Front Wheel Alignment on Toyota FJ40 vehicle. Which aims to produce stability in driving the vehicle and find out what are the causes of front wheel alignment instability. The geometric aspect and size of the front wheels, which consists of Camber, Caster, Toe Angel, Kingpin inclination, and Turning radius are important parts of the Alignment Front Wheel. If one of the wheel alignment elements is not suitable then it would cause instability for the driver. The maximum time and distance of wheel maintenance and Front wheel alignment care are needed to keep it stable so that regular maintenance is carried out every 10,000 km and constantly check the physical condition of the tire to avoid slipping while driving.
